Dry weather forecast in Jharkhand with rise in max. temp.

PINAKI MAJUMDAR

 

Jamshedpur, March 24: The summer heat is going to increase in Jharkhand.

IMD’s Ranchi Meteorological Centre today predicted a rise in maximum temperature by 4-6 degrees Celsius across the state in the next four days.

Weathermen ruled out the possibility of thunderstorm activity in the next few days.

“The weather condition would be mainly clear and dry over the state in the next few days,” said a duty officer.

The official went on to say that the maximum temperature which had witnessed an abrupt fall in the past few days due to the thunderstorm and rainfall activity would again witness a gradual rise.

Today’s satellite pictures showed a trough in westerlies in middle and upper tropospheric levels with its axis between 5.8 and 7.6 Km above mean sea level roughly along Long. 84°E to the north of Lat. 20°N .

A cyclonic circulation over northeast Assam and neighbourhood persists and was today seen at 1.5 km above the mean sea level.
